Nov. 3 Luncheon: Opening of $66 Million Gulfshore Playhouse

When Gulfshore Playhouse premiers its $66 million state-of-the-art Baker Theatre and Education Center in the fall of 2023, it will be the first major cultural arts center to be built in Naples in more than 30 years.

Please join us on Thursday, Nov. 3, at the Hilton Naples to hear Kimberly Dye, Gulfshore Playhouse Chief Advancement Officer, address the theatre’s leadership role in helping to transform cultural arts in Southwest Florida and its economic impact on the area. She will also offer a sneak peek into upcoming productions this season.

Kimberly is responsible for the professional theatre’s development and marketing teams and spearheads its capital campaign. Her background includes working in public broadcasting for more than a dozen years, building nonprofit organizations from the ground up, teaching at the university level, and serving as chief of staff to a university president.
